Vaishno Devi — Jammu & Kashmir

The Vaishno Devi shrine in the Trikuta mountains draws over 8 million pilgrims annually. The base camp is Katra (50 km from Jammu). From Katra, a 14 km trek leads to the cave shrine. Cab to Katra from Jammu: 1 hr. From Delhi to Katra: 650 km, 12 hrs.

Tirupati Balaji — Andhra Pradesh

Sri Venkateswara temple at Tirumala is the world's most visited place of worship. The temple receives over 50,000 devotees daily. Cab from Hyderabad: 550 km, 7 hrs. Cab from Chennai: 140 km, 3 hrs. Book darshan tickets online in advance.

Shirdi Sai Baba — Maharashtra

Shirdi receives 25,000+ devotees every day. The Samadhi Mandir is open 4am–11pm. Most pilgrims arrive early morning for the Kakad Arti at 4:30am. Cab from Pune: 183 km, 3 hrs. Cab from Mumbai: 250 km, 4.5 hrs.

Varanasi — Uttar Pradesh

The holiest city in Hinduism, on the banks of the Ganges. The Kashi Vishwanath temple is the most sacred Shiva shrine. The Ganga Aarti at Dashashwamedh Ghat at sunset is unmissable. Cab from Lucknow: 300 km, 5 hrs. Cab from Prayagraj: 125 km, 3 hrs.

Dwarka — Gujarat

One of the Char Dham (four sacred Hindu abodes). Dwarkadhish Temple on the Arabian Sea coast is dedicated to Lord Krishna. Cab from Ahmedabad: 450 km, 7 hrs. Cab from Rajkot: 220 km, 3.5 hrs.

Puri Jagannath — Odisha

Puri is home to the famous Jagannath Temple and the annual Rath Yatra chariot festival. Cab from Bhubaneswar: 60 km, 1.5 hrs. Cab from Kolkata: 500 km, 9 hrs.

Golden Temple — Amritsar, Punjab

Harmandir Sahib (Golden Temple) is the holiest Sikh shrine, open 24 hours to all faiths. Free langar (community meals) served round the clock. Cab from Delhi: 450 km, 7 hrs. Cab from Chandigarh: 230 km, 4 hrs.

Tips for Pilgrimage Travel by Cab

- Book early morning pickups for dawn Artis and darshan

- Request a driver familiar with the destination for temple routes

- Carry your ID — Aadhar/PAN required at many temple entries

- Round-trip cab is strongly recommended — return cabs are scarce at popular sites

- Confirm waiting charges if driver waits during darshan
